New York Senate Bill 4245: Establishes the independent office of the child advocate to ensure the protection and promotion of the rights of children in the care of any state agency or local social services district.
New York · 2025-2026 session
What it does
Establishes the independent office of the child advocate to ensure the protection and promotion of the rights of children in the care of any state agency or local social services district.
Latest action
REFERRED TO CHILDREN AND FAMILIES (2026-01-07)
